After a beta testing phase this summer for their custom seat segment, Mustang Motorcycle Products LLC will attend the International Motorcycle Show Dec. 13-15 at the Jacob Javits Center. As an added attraction, custom bike enthusiasts will be treated to a sneak peek at the Perewitz “Signature Series” seats at the NYC IMS event.
New England bike customizer Dave Perewitz will be displaying several of his creations in the J&P Cycles Ultimate Builder Custom Bike Show area, including a Pro Street Bagger with a Mustang seat, as well as a 2013 Custom FL Bagger featuring a Perewitz Signature Seat by Mustang. Dave isn’t the only Perewitz in the house; his daughter is bringing her record setting bike to NYC this weekend as artist Eric Herrmann will unveil his new painting of Jody Perewitz, the world’s fastest woman.
“The painting is 22 inches x 28 inches — I can’t wait to see it in person,” says Perewitz. “Eric and my dad will both be in the Team J’witz booth, along with my race bike.”
“We are working closely with Dave and Jody Perewitz on the upcoming line of Signature Seats … the ones on display are pre-production prototypes, but they might give you an idea where we are going with these designs,” said marketing director Marilyn Simmons. “More details will follow in a couple months for the Perewitz seats, but if you can’t wait, we will also be showing off our Custom Seat Program, which gives you the opportunity to design your own seat.”
The Perewitz custom bikes, the Eric Herrmann painting and Jody’s record setting bike will all be on display at the IMS stop in New York.
